Amazon says they could make Alexa sound just like one your DEAD RELATIVE

Imagine being able to change the voice of YOUR ALexa to something MUCH more familiar. A a conference the week, Rohit Prasad, who is a company Vice President and developer of Alexa, said the desire behind this ability was to build greater trust in the interactions users have with Alexa by putting more "human attributes of empathy and affect." "These attributes have become even more important during the ongoing pandemic when so many of us have lost ones that we love," Prasad said. "While AI can't eliminate that pain of loss, it can definitely make their memories last."

Using as short sample of someone's voice, Amazon says they will be able to give your device the ability to 'Mimic' the desired voice, even the voice of someone who has passed away! Here's more from ABC Chicago.
